Adobe Dreamweaver CS4 en Ubuntu Linux 9.04

Hace algunos días, por breves instantes, logré correr Adobe Dreamweaver CS4 en Wine bajo Ubuntu Linux. Luego toqué algo que no se que fue y no volvió a funcionar.

Así que hoy decidí ver si podía hacerlo funcionar. Voy a ir documentando los pasos que voy siguiendo a ver. Espero que les sirva de algo.

Nota Importante: Estas instrucciones sirven con Wine 1.1.26 y 1.1.27. Wine 1.1.28 cambia algo y Dreamweaver no corre. Se cuelga al lanzarlo. Actualización: 1.1.29 y 1.1.30 tampoco funcionan.

Actualización: 1.1.36 sí funciona. De hecho funcionó con sólo darle clic al exe del Portable.

Cómo correr Adobe Dreamweaver CS4 en Ubuntu Linux 9.04 (Jaunty Jackalope)

Primero que todo, en este momento tengo instalado:

  • Ubuntu 9.04 Jaunty Jackalope
  • Wine 1.1.26
  • Adobe CS4 bajo Windows en Dual Boot

Debes conseguir una versión “Stand alone” o “Portable” de Dreamweaver. Esta versión corre sin instalación.

Ahora veamos el proceso:

  1. Copia el directorio :\Program Files\Adobe\Adobe Dreamweaver CS4 a tu directorio ~/.wine/drive_c/Program Files/Adobe/Adobe Dreamweaver CS4
  2. Copia el directorio :\Documents and Settings\tu_usario\Application Data\Adobe\DreamWeaver CS4 a ~/.wine/drive_c/users/tu_usuario/Application Data/Dreamweaver CS4
  3. Copia el directorio: :\Program Files\Common Files\Adobe a ~/.wine/drive_c/Program Files/Common Files
  4. Copia el contenido del directorio :\WINDOWS\WinSxS al directorio ~/.wine/drive_c/windows/winsxs (nota que en wine es todo en minúsculas).
  5. Ahora bootea a Windows. Necesitamos exportar la porción de Dreamweaver del registro de Windows.
  6. Una vez en Windows, vas a Inicio > Ejecutar > regedit y le das Enter. Buscas HKEY_LOCAL_MACHINE/Software/Adobe/Dreamweaver y exportas todo eso a dreamweaver.reg en tu disco duro, en un lugar que lo puedas encontrar fácilmente.
  7. Bootea de nuevo a Ubuntu, te vas a donde guardaste el dreamweaver.reg y haces lo siguiente:sudo apt-get install
    recode ucs-2..ascii dreamweaver.reg
    wine regedit dreamweaver.reg
  8. Entra a tu terminal y corres el comando wine Dreamweaver.exe

Ten en cuenta algo importante, en Linux, las mayúsculas cuentan en los nombre, de manera que WinSxS no es igual a winsxs. Debes dejarlo en minúsculas. También debes cambiar a minúsculas el directorio “winsxs/manifests”

Ya debe funcionar Dreamweaver en tu máquina, aunque el resultado no es 100% Seguro. En algunas máquinas sencillamente no funciona.

Cuéntanos como te va a ti.

Dreamweaver arrancando

Adobe Dreamweaver CS4 cargando bajo Ubuntu Linux 9.04 con Wine 1.1.26

dreamweaver_02

Adobe Dreamweaver CS4 mostrando la pantalla inicial bajo Ubuntu Linux 9.04 con Wine 1.1.26

Fuente: http://noteearty.blogspot.com/2008/01/how-to-run-dreamweaver-cs3-in-ubuntu.html (Utilicé las mismas instrucciones, pero adaptadas a CS4).

Actualización 21 nov 2009: A decir verdad ya ni intento correrlo bajo Wine. Lo que hago ahora es que instalé VirtualBox y dentro de eso instalé Dreamweaver, Flash y hasta Office 2007.

Comments

  1. Pues la verdad es que finalmente me decidí por virtualizar Windows, esperemos que Adobe se de cuenta de que los linuxeros también apreciamos sus herramientas.

  2. Eso es lo que mucho quisieramos, pero Adobe ha dicho especificamente que no le interesa, pues no tiene pruebas de que en realidad hayan tantos usuarios de Linux como aseguramos nosotros.

    Se dice que al menos habemos tanto como los usuarios de Mac.

  3. Si no existiese Wine, estariamos mas en la edad de piedra que ahora, pero Wine solo soporta aplicaciones viejas, es dificil que acepta versiones nuevas donde como en tu caso, has casi hecho magia para lograr hacerlo funcionar en linux.

    En Dreamweaver CS3 y CS4 (no se CS2 o CS1) ya vienen unas herramientas que no estan en las versiones MX y 8, por lo que aunque Wine acepte MX y 8 como instalacion sin problemas, ya se estaria trabajando muy atrasadamente.

    Ser un webmaster de hacerlo todo a mano (linea por linea de codigo html, php, etc) no es algo que muchos considerarian correcto o aceptable. Virtualizar un Windows para trabajar solo nos hace recordar que realmente aun no somos usuarios Linux, seguimos siendo usuarios Windows contenidos en un recipiente Linux que para trabajo (laboralmente, productivamente) seguimos recurriendo a Windows, porque no son los sistemas operativos por lo que la gente los usas, sino por las aplicaciones con las que podemos trabajar en dicha plataforma, mientras esto no cambie, mientras las aplicaciones no evolucionen y rindan como sus equivalentes en otros sistemas, no habra mucho auje de cambio a linux por culpa de una necesidad que aun sigue estando mas cubierta en otras plataformas de trabajo, esperando que algun dia esto cambie, pero no siempre tenemos el tiempo o paciencia para esperar tanto.

    Un saludo, buen articulo.

  4. Hola Jose,

    Gracias por tu comentario. Estoy de acuerdo contigo en un 100%.

    Como un comentario aparte, hay una aplicación muy interesante, de código abierto, y que corre en Windows, Mac y Linux para desarrollo de sitios web y se llama Aptana Studio ( http://www.aptana.org/ ). También tienen una para desarrollo de RubyonRails: Aptana RadRails ( http://aptana.com/ ).

  5. Muchas gracias Nugar.

    Si habia escuchado de Aptana y aun tengo pendiente descargarlo, unos problemas serios con mi ubuntu9.04 hace unos dias mi hicieron tenerlo que reinstalar que pasar horas o dias tratando de corregirlo, preferi la opcion mas rapida y descargar aptana me quedo pendiente aun, porque Kompiz es inestable y no le llega ni por las rodillas a Dreamweaver.

    Vere mas afondo Aptana y comparare haber si ya puede trabajarse mas nativamente o si aun se tiene que recurrir a cosas mas externas.

    un saludo.

  6. Hola Jose,

    Yo creo que todo depende de tener una buena herramienta y adaptarse a ella, pero siempre teniendo en cuenta las necesidades de la persona que las va a usar.

    Yo por ejemplo el Dreamweaver lo uso mas que nada por su facilidad en conectarse directamente al servidor mediante ftp o sftp y asi puedo editar en vivo. Ya ultimamente no lo uso mucho por el aspecto de WYSIWYG, porque el que hace la parte de diseño es mi socio y yo lo adapto al web, usando básicamente php. De manera que aunque Dreamweaver es mi programa favorito para editar codigo *html y php, en realidad no uso todas las facilidades que provee.

    En ese sentido, baje el Aptana Studio, el cual interesantemente no trae por defecto instalado el modulo de php y me parecio muy bueno. Tiene esa opcion tambien de conectarse al servidor directamente y editar el archivo, el cual es subido nuevamente al salvarlo.

    Por otro lado, en mi flujo de trabajo, tengo dos monitores, de manera que puedo ir editando en el monitor principal y tener un navegador abierto en el monitor secundario y actualizarlo cada vez que actualizo algo en el codigo.

    Es muy conveniente.

    Asi que en general, creo que es más fácil trabajar con código fuente ahora y definitivamente más fácil que trabajar con imágenes. ¡Eso sí me tiene frito!

  7. Estoy de acuerdo

    Claro esta que en tu caso como dices, las web son mantenidas por mas de una persona, cuando es asi, claro que uno se dedica de lleno o mas a una parte y otras personas hacen el diseno, etc. Para el caso cuando el webmaster debe hacerlo todo, si creo que Dreamweaver es la mejor opcion. Veo que Aptana es hasta estas fechas, el que esta mas a la cabeza a compararse con Dreamweaver, aun no lo alcanza pero ya al menos puede verse una parte de como va quedando el diseno y ayuda colocando algo de codigo y autocompletandolo, agilizando la labor y reduciendo los errores de sintaxis.

    Porque esperando a Adobe, creo que seran nuestros hijos los que tal vez vean luz esa suite que nosotros ahora.

  8. En efecto aun no lo alcanza. Me pregunto cuantos desarrolladores tendra Adobe dedicados a Dreamweaver y cuantos se dedican a Aptana.

    Me llamó la atención de Aptana que en si es como un IDE para varios lenguajes, pero en sí PHP no viene instalado por defecto. Tuve que bajarlo e instalarlo (muy fácilmente) para que entonces apareciera el código con colores, etc.

    Pero algo que sí vi es que se puede instalar por ejemplo servidor local de PHP, MySQL e ir trabajando el sitio localmente y verlo en el navegador localmente también. Eso tiene su conveniencia porque no estás trabajando en vivo, al aire, sino que lo subes cuando estas listo.

    Creo que hay que mantener el ojo en Aptana a ver como se va desarrollando…

  9. una pregunta… como me paso por los Tabs (pestanas) cuando tengo varias paginas web cargadas en aptana, sin uso del mouse, algo como Alt+Tab o algo parecido, por teclado, porque cuando uno escribe, solo toco el mouse para pasarme de una pestana a otra.

  10. La verdad es que no se! No he profundizado en eso aun, pero ahora que llego a casa me fijare a ver. En que sistema operativo lo estas usando?

  11. ubuntu 9.04
    no es que sea algo muy importante, pero igual lance la pregunta porque haciendo algunas combinaciones de teclas, y para alguien acostumbrado a puro teclado (mas en caso de laptops) recurrir solo al mouse (en el caso de aptana) solo para moverse entre paginas en el programa, pues…. simplemente da curiosidad.
    Aptana se ve bien automatizado hasta lo poco que he visto, y que no haga cambio Alt-Tab entre pestanas o Tab de paginas abiertas, seria raro, no sea que se les haya pasado eso por alto.

  12. Bueno, me puse a ver y en efecto, sí hay una serie de comandos, pero no se hasta que punto sean buenos en laptop. Por ejemplo, Ctrl-AvPag y Crtl-RePag te permite ir ciclando por las pestañas.

    Ctrl-F6 produce un menu en el cual puedes escoger una de las pestañas.

    Hay varios de estos trucos en el archivo de ayuda, bajo la categoría “Tips and Tricks”. Muy conveniente!

  13. Ctrl-AvPag y Crtl-RePag no me sirvieron pero Ctrl-F6 no es muy util, pero chequeare la ayuda. Gracias Nugar, saludos.

  14. Estoy de acuerdo con las opiniones de los que han comentado. Yo también estoy poco a poco dejando de usar dreamweaver y estoy utilizando aptana porque prefiero ultimamente trabajar con el codigo antes que con un editor grafico.

    El principal problema que tengo con aptana es que no tiene la funcionalidad de dreamweaver a la hora de hacer y actualizar automaticamente plantillas. Esta es la principal razon por la que sigo usando dreamweaver, ya que esta funcion hace el trabajo mucho más rapido y facil.

    Espero que aptana siga desarrollandose e incorpore funciones como esta.

  15. no tiene caso que hallas instalado dreamweaver y los otros en virtualbox si al final sigues dependiendo de windows ya que instalaste windows y en el las aplicaciones

  16. Lo bueno del software libre es precisamente eso, que eres libre de hacer lo que desees.

    Y lo que yo deseaba era instalar Dreamweaver, porque ese el programa que me gusta. Acepto que no le he metido mucho a Aptana, por ejemplo, pero en su momento lo haré.

  17. Hola el tutorial muy bueno instale Adobe Dreamweaver CS4 sin problemas gracias por el aporte fue de mucha ayuda.

  18. no le veo sentido a virtualizar ¬¬ a la final virtualizaste windows ,,, entonces porque no desinstalas linux y dejas el windows ???.

  19. El problema es que Windows es muy inseguro y es abierto a todo tipo de malware. Al correr un sistema operativo linux, estas mucho más protegido. Si algo pasa dentro de tu maquina virtual, sencillamente la borras, pues es un archivo y creas otra.

    Hoy en día la virtualización es el pan nuestro de cada día. Puede suceder que hayas contratado el servicio de alojamiento con entorno Windows y resulte que en realidad el servidor fisico en el cual esta tu sitio corre Linux Red Hat pero tiene tu sitio virtualizado en Windows.

  20. oye no cerre el drem porque me deice que le falta una libreria dll al wine que hay que hacer

  21. Hola Ivan,

    Mira la actualización que puse en noviembre de 2009. Ya ni intento correrlo en Wine, así que no tengo respuesta a tu pregunta.

    Lo que hago es instalar Windows XP dentro de VirtualBox, y correrlo desde allí.

  22. yo necesito el D4L (dreamweaver for linux) alguien sabe donde puedo conseguirlo no encuentro informacion en la red
    o como instalarlo en ubuntu 11?

Deja un comentario

A %d blogueros les gusta esto: